Marian Demar & Orkiestra Syrena Rekord dir. by Iwo Wesby – Cicho grajcie mi znów [Play Me Softly Again; Original Italian title: Violino Tzigano] Tango (Bixio-Brojdo) Recorded by Syrena-Electro, Poland in 1937. Repressed by White Eagle Records in USA, c. 1949
NOTE: This is a Polish version of the world-famous Italian tango "Violino Tzigano," composed by Cesare A. Bixio - one of the best Italian pop music composers of the radio days. Marian DEMAR (b. 1897 in Kraków - d. 1979 in Kraków, Poland) was a popular Polish tenor, performing in operettas and on the radio, who initially studied at the Vienna Polytechnic, but decided to pursue a singing career in 1926. He sang in Polish opera houses in Poznań, Kraków and Warsaw, and then became popular as a performer of popular arias and hits on radio and on records in the 1930s. During the German occupation, he agreed to perform in public theaters administered by the Nazis, so after World War II he was banned from performing on Warsaw stages and for the rest of his career he appeared only in the musical theaters in Kraków.
